From dca10903ff54a8999732695b5c2a0a5c94f85200 Mon Sep 17 00:00:00 2001 From: Zoe Roux Date: Fri, 6 Aug 2021 12:08:21 +0200 Subject: [PATCH 1/2] ItemUtils: Fixing date display --- src/app/misc/items-utils.ts |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/src/app/misc/items-utils.ts b/src/app/misc/items-utils.ts index 395acbd7..649f2fc6 100644 --- a/src/app/misc/items-utils.ts +++ b/src/app/misc/items-utils.ts @@ -26,7 +26,7 @@ export class ItemsUtils if (!("startAir" in item)) return ""; - if (item.endAir && item.startAir !== item.endAir) + if (item.endAir && item.startAir?.getFullYear() !== item.endAir.getFullYear()) return `${item.startAir.getFullYear()} - ${item.endAir.getFullYear()}`; return item.startAir?.getFullYear().toString(); } From e2941691f3f57523f2094a036bf10017195f1b58 Mon Sep 17 00:00:00 2001 From: Zoe Roux Date: Thu, 19 Aug 2021 17:56:14 +0200 Subject: [PATCH 2/2] Using absolute url for authentication --- src/app/auth/auth.module.ts | 10 +++++----- 1 file changed, 5 insertions(+), 5 deletions(-) diff --git a/src/app/auth/auth.module.ts b/src/app/auth/auth.module.ts index 9a1135ca..4190f58c 100644 --- a/src/app/auth/auth.module.ts +++ b/src/app/auth/auth.module.ts @@ -29,19 +29,19 @@ export function loadConfig(oidcConfigService: OidcConfigService): () => Promise< { return () => oidcConfigService.withConfig({ stsServer: window.location.origin, - redirectUrl: "/", - postLogoutRedirectUri: "/logout", + redirectUrl: `${window.location.origin}/`, + postLogoutRedirectUri: `${window.location.origin}/logout`, clientId: "kyoo.webapp", responseType: "code", triggerAuthorizationResultEvent: false, scope: "openid profile offline_access kyoo.read kyoo.write kyoo.play kyoo.admin", silentRenew: true, - silentRenewUrl: "/silent.html", + silentRenewUrl: `${window.location.origin}/silent.html`, useRefreshToken: true, startCheckSession: true, - forbiddenRoute: "/forbidden", - unauthorizedRoute: "/unauthorized", + forbiddenRoute: `${window.location.origin}/forbidden`, + unauthorizedRoute: `${window.location.origin}/unauthorized`, logLevel: LogLevel.Warn }); }